I thought: Oh my God, that's me." Arfid stands for avoidant/restrictive food intake disorder, a condition identified some years ago, and it is not just about being a picky eater.
People with ARFID avoid many foods due to sensory aversions to taste, consistency, smell or appearance. They can also experience a fear of negative consequences of eating, such as choking or vomiting.
